Home
last modified time | relevance | path

Searched refs:R2Vector (Results 1 – 6 of 6) sorted by relevance

/external/s2-geometry-library-java/src/com/google/common/geometry/
DR2Vector.java24 public final strictfp class R2Vector { class
28 public R2Vector() { in R2Vector() method in R2Vector
32 public R2Vector(double x, double y) { in R2Vector() method in R2Vector
37 public R2Vector(double[] coord) { in R2Vector() method in R2Vector
60 public static R2Vector add(final R2Vector p1, final R2Vector p2) { in add()
61 return new R2Vector(p1.x + p2.x, p1.y + p2.y); in add()
64 public static R2Vector mul(final R2Vector p, double m) { in mul()
65 return new R2Vector(m * p.x, m * p.y); in mul()
72 public static double dotProd(final R2Vector p1, final R2Vector p2) { in dotProd()
76 public double dotProd(R2Vector that) { in dotProd()
[all …]
DS2.java658 planarOrderedCCW(new R2Vector(a.y, a.z), new R2Vector(b.y, b.z), new R2Vector(c.y, c.z)); in expensiveCCW()
661 planarOrderedCCW(new R2Vector(a.z, a.x), new R2Vector(b.z, b.x), new R2Vector(c.z, c.x)); in expensiveCCW()
664 new R2Vector(a.x, a.y), new R2Vector(b.x, b.y), new R2Vector(c.x, c.y)); in expensiveCCW()
672 public static int planarCCW(R2Vector a, R2Vector b) { in planarCCW()
675 R2Vector vab = R2Vector.add(a, R2Vector.mul(b, sab)); in planarCCW()
693 public static int planarOrderedCCW(R2Vector a, R2Vector b, R2Vector c) { in planarOrderedCCW()
DS2Cell.java139 R2Vector uvMid = getCenterUV(); in subdivide()
181 public R2Vector getCenterUV() { in getCenterUV()
194 return new R2Vector(x, y); in getCenterUV()
367 R2Vector uvPoint = S2Projections.faceXyzToUv(face, p); in contains()
DS2Projections.java288 public static R2Vector validFaceXyzToUv(int face, S2Point p) { in validFaceXyzToUv()
318 return new R2Vector(pu, pv); in validFaceXyzToUv()
329 public static R2Vector faceXyzToUv(int face, S2Point p) { in faceXyzToUv()
DS2CellId.java150 R2Vector uv = S2Projections.validFaceXyzToUv(face, p); in fromPoint()
868 R2Vector st = S2Projections.validFaceXyzToUv(face, p); in fromFaceIJWrap()
/external/s2-geometry-library-java/tests/com/google/common/geometry/
DS2CellIdTest.java198 R2Vector uv = S2Projections.validFaceXyzToUv(face, p); in testContinuity()